Family tree revealed for RTE drama Smother as many viewers left confused

Since premiering last week, RTÈ's new drama Smother impressed viewers with its moody atmosphere, macabre mystery, and solid performance.

However, like so many thrillers and mysteries, the plot was quite intricate with alliances, secrets, and plenty of characters playing a pivotal role.

In terms of the general synopsis, Smother unfolds after Val Ahern’s husband, Denis, is found dead at a foot of a cliff close to her home the morning after a family party.

Val begins to pick through the events of the previous night to examine Denis’s relationships with his children, step-children and his siblings in order to find out who might have been responsible for his brutal death.

The deeper that the matriarch delves into her family’s secrets, the more she realises how her late husband’s controlling and manipulative behaviour had affected each member of the family in their own way.
